On June 3–4, 2026, we invite you to join us at the Charles Sadron Institute in Strasbourg for the third edition of the “Nano-Est” Days.

This event is co-organized by the FRMNGE (Fédération de Recherche Matériaux et Nanosciences du Grand Est) and C’Nano Est.

These two days will bring together invited speakers, early-career researchers, PhD students, and thesis award winners, through oral presentations and poster sessions.

The event will be held mainly in French. However, to ensure accessibility for everyone, presentation slides must be prepared in English.

👉 Please note: English-speaking participants are welcome to give their presentations in English.

Presentation of the winner of the C'Nano regional & national thesis prize:

Yihui CAI – for his thesis carried out at ICPEES – Mechanosynthesis of 3D, 2D and quasi-2D hybrid perovskites and MAPbI₃/graphite composites: mechanisms and potential applications

Théo Duarte DE ASSUNCAO – for his thesis carried out at L2n – Carbon nanoparticles for the secure marking of cultural artifacts
